在区块链技术的迅速发展中,以太坊(Ethereum)已成为一个极为重要的平台。与比特币不同,以太坊不仅是一种数字货币,它还是一个支持智能合约的去中心化平台。在以太坊上,ERC20 Token的出现彻底改变了数字资产的创建和管理方式。本文将深入探讨ERC20 Token的机制、功能、实际应用及其可能的发展前景。

什么是ERC20 Token?

ERC20 Token是基于以太坊区块链的一种代币标准。由Ethereum社区开发并于2015年发布,ERC20成为了开发者在以太坊上创建代币的基本标准。其核心理念是为代币的创建提供统一的技术规范,从而确保不同代币之间的互操作性和兼容性。

ERC20的“ERC”代表Ethereum Request for Comments,而“20”则是该提案的数字标识符。该标准定义了代币的基本功能,包括如何转移代币、如何查看余额、如何授予和撤销代币的审批等。通过遵循ERC20标准,开发者可以确保他们的代币可以在以太坊生态系统中无缝地进行交易和交互。

ERC20 Token的基本特征

: 全面解析以太坊 ERC20 Token:功能、应用与发展

ERC20 Token具有以下几个主要特征:

  • 可互换性:ERC20 Token是可互换的,意味着同一种类型的代币是等值和互换的,比如1个Token可以与另一个相同Token交换。
  • 转让性:ERC20标准允许用户自由地转移代币,用户只需通过简单的智能合约调用即可完成交易。
  • 简便性:ERC20 Tokens的创建与管理相对简单,开发者可以利用以太坊的现有基础设施,而不必从头开发。
  • 可编程性:由于使用了智能合约,ERC20 Token允许开发者添加定制的功能和逻辑,使其具有灵活性和多样性。

ERC20 Token的发展历程与应用

自ERC20标准发布以来,数以千计的代币相继在以太坊上创建。其中,一些最著名的代币包括ChainLink(LINK)、Uniswap (UNI)、USD Coin (USDC)等。这些代币涵盖了多种应用场景,涉及金融、资产管理、游戏甚至慈善等多个领域。

从2017年开始,以太坊的ICO(首次代币发行)热潮吸引了大量投资者,这进一步推动了ERC20 Token的普及。在这波热潮中,很多项目通过发行ERC20 Token为自己的项目融资,同时也使得ERC20 Token成为了投资者和开发者的重要工具。

在以太坊生态系统中的作用

: 全面解析以太坊 ERC20 Token:功能、应用与发展

ERC20令以太坊生态系统发生了巨大的变化。它使得在以太坊平台上创建新的代币变得简单而高效。通过ERC20,开发者能够快速创建新的代币,借助以太坊的去中心化特性,保证其安全性和透明性。

ERC20 Token不仅促进了以太坊的增长,也推动了整个区块链行业的创新。许多新兴项目利用这一标准开发自己独特的应用,推动去中心化金融(DeFi)、非同质化代币(NFT)等领域的蓬勃发展。

ERC20 Token的技术架构

ERC20 Token的技术架构基于以太坊的智能合约。具体而言,ERC20标准规定了应实现的一组功能。这些功能包括:

  • totalSupply:
  • balanceOf:
  • transfer:
  • approve:
  • transferFrom:
  • allowance:

ERC20 Token的使用案例

以下是几个关于ERC20 Token的典型应用案例:

1. 去中心化金融(DeFi): DeFi通过区块链为传统金融服务提供替代方案。许多DeFi协议使用ERC20 Token作为其核心资产,例如借贷平台Compound和交易所Uniswap都使用ERC20来提供流动性和交易。

2. 游戏行业: ERC20 Token在游戏行业中作为奖励或虚拟货币也得到了广泛应用。许多游戏允许玩家以ERC20 Token进行交易,增强了用户体验并增加了玩家参与度。

3. 社交平台: 一些社交平台使用ERC20 Token作为激励机制,鼓励用户生成内容。例如,用户可以通过发布高质量帖子获得代币奖励,这些代币可以在平台内进行交易或兑换。

<-- 以下为问题部分 -->

ERC20 Token的安全性问题

随着ERC20 Token的普及,随之而来的安全性问题也是一个不容忽视的方面。由于ERC20代币是通过智能合约生成的,因此其安全性往往取决于合约的编写质量和逻辑的复杂性。实际应用中,许多代币的智能合约曾出现安全漏洞,导致资金损失。例如,2017年,Parity钱包的一个漏洞使得数百万美元的代币被锁定。

要确保ERC20 Token的安全性,开发者应遵循最佳实践,例如尽量简化智能合约的逻辑,以及在许多情况下需要进行代码审核。此外,社区也在不断推动合规化,许多项目在创建代币时均需要提供源代码并接受公众的审查。

ERC20 Token与NFT的区别

ERC20 Token与NFT(非同质化代币)之间有显著区别。ERC20是一种同质化代币,即每个代币都是相同和可互换的。相反,NFT代表唯一的资产或权益,彼此之间不具备可替代性。ERC721是专为NFT设计的标准。

这些区别使得ERC20 Token更适合用于货币、股权等领域,而NFT则更适合用于艺术品、游戏道具、收藏品等独特资产的交易。随着市场的发展,ERC20和NFT之间的边界逐渐模糊,例如一些项目将ERC20 Token与NFT结合,以创建创新的资产类别,进一步推动区块链的应用。

ERC20 Token的法律合规性问题

随着ERC20 Token的在多个国家的合法性受到质疑,法律合规性问题变得尤为重要。不同国家和地区对数字资产的监管政策差异很大。目前,一些国家对ERC20 Token的发行认定为证券,要求其遵循严格的证券法,这大大限制了代币的自由交易和流通。

为了确保合规性,许多项目选择在初期阶段遵循国际金融监管框架,确保透明度和合法性。此外,还有一些项目探索合规的创新方式,例如采用合规的ICO或STO(证券型代币发行)。

未来ERC20 Token的发展方向

展望未来,ERC20 Token的发展方向可能会朝着几个方面延伸。首先,随着DeFi的继续发展,ERC20 Token可能会与更多的金融工具和平台进行结合,为用户提供更强大的功能与体验。

其次,随着区块链技术的进一步成熟,ERC20 Token的安全性与合规性将得到充分保障。同时,开发者社区的不断壮大,将有助于推动ERC20 Token的技术革新,例如跨链技术的发展使得代币更容易在不同区块链间流转。

最后,在数字资产的价值映射与社会应用场景中,ERC20 Token将继续发挥重要的作用,推动更广泛的用户接受度及多元化的应用实例的出现,让区块链的潜能最大程度地释放!

通过本文的介绍,我们深入探讨了ERC20 Token的基本知识和实际应用,通过回答相关问题,进一步理解其在以太坊生态系统的重要性。随着区块链行业不断发展,ERC20 Token无疑将会继续在未来的数字经济中发挥重要作用。